L'industrie textile est soumise à une pression croissante pour respecter les normes environnementales | The Business Times
The textile industry faces rising scrutiny for its immense water usage—over 80 billion cubic metres annually—driven by fast fashion and production automation. With a single cotton t-shirt requiring more than 2,700 litres of water, the sector is under pressure to adopt sustainable water treatment solutions to meet tightening environmental standards and shifting consumer expectations.

Gradiant favorise la croissance durable de la Chine grâce à des solutions innovantes de traitement des eaux usées
Gradiant China at the IE Expo China 2019 showcased advanced wastewater treatment technologies tailored to local industrial needs. Featuring the Carrier Gas Extraction (CGE) system, Gradiant highlighted its success at Shanghai Electric’s Ligang coal power plant—achieving over 90% water recovery and compliance with stringent environmental regulations through cost-effective and sustainable solutions.
